The NTB Provincial Government is accelerating preparations for two Motocross Grand Prix (MXGP) events to be held on Sumbawa and Lombok Island respectively. "We have already held preliminary meetings. God willing, everything will run smoothly," said NTB Governor Zulkieflimansyah.

The Indonesian MXGP race series will begin on Sumbawa Island, with a circuit located in the Samota area of Sumbawa Regency, on June 25th. Afterward, it will shift to Lombok Island on July 2nd. For the Lombok race, MXGP is likely to be held at the former Selaparang Airport in the city of Mataram.

Zul stated that MXGP is not just a world-class racing event, and it is not intended to enrich the organizing committee. "This event is a catalyst for the economy in NTB to have a good system," he said.

With the holding of MXGP, the government is also improving various racing-supporting infrastructure. Moreover, in the field of economics, according to Zul, improving infrastructure is one of the efforts that can support economic growth.

Jack stated that IMI NTB has inventoried all the facilities and infrastructure at each venue. The document was then handed over to SEG, so that they could consider the selection of the MXGP race location in Lombok.

"It is most likely at the former Selaparang airport due to several considerations from Infront," he said.

The construction of the circuit at the former Selaparang Airport is planned to begin after Ramadan. This is because they are still waiting for the circuit layout design from Infront. "After this month of fasting, we will start building," said Jack.
